Linking these AI identifiers to Zapier opens extensive automation opportunities. As an example, for reviewing ChatGPT results, configure a Zap that starts upon new material creation through an OpenAI link. The sequence might direct the writing to GPTZero or Copyleaks for review, then alert via message or Slack if AI elements surface. Procedures involve: 1) Link your Zapier profile to the identifier's API (many provide Zapier modules or webhooks); 2) Establish a starting event, like 'New Document in Google Docs'; 3) Include a step to forward the writing for evaluation; 4) Apply conditions to accept or mark outcomes per score levels. This arrangement conserves effort, notably for groups with heavy content traffic, and might include syntax tools like Grammarly for full assessment.

Step 1: Define Your Trigger
Begin by accessing your Zapier profile and selecting 'Create Zap.' The trigger represents the occurrence that launches the sequence. In material review, typical starters encompass fresh files in Google Docs or arriving messages with files. To configure a Google Docs starter:
- Pick Google Docs as the service and opt for 'New Document' as the event.
- Link your Google profile and choose the targeted directory or storage to watch.
- Validate the starter by making a trial file to confirm Zapier retrieves the information properly.
Should you track messages, select Gmail or your provider, and define the starter as 'New Attachment' or 'New Email Matching Search.' This grabs material inputs from colleagues or outside contributors. Such starters guarantee your Zapier sequence launches on its own when fresh material enters, eliminating constant monitoring.

Step 2: Add Detection Actions with Integrated Apps
Following the trigger, incorporate review steps. Zapier accommodates numerous services for this, such as Microsoft Word for file handling and web-based revisers like Grammarly or dedicated AI review solutions.
- Include an action phase by looking up your selected service. For Microsoft Word linkage through OneDrive or Microsoft 365, choose 'Upload File' or 'Create Document' to manage the arriving file.
- When employing a web reviser, attach it to execute an automated step that checks for AI-created traits. For example, channel the Google Docs material into a webhooks step that invokes an AI review API (such as OpenAI's categorizers or external providers).
Set the automated step to inspect writing for AI indicators, like repeated wording or odd smoothness. Zapier’s inherent formatter can prepare text beforehand-pulling main body from Google Docs or message files-prior to dispatch to the review service. This configuration renders your Zapier sequence an effective sentinel, blending Microsoft Word for concluding adjustments if required.
Step 3: Automate Alerts and Verification
Post-review, configure steps to manage outcomes. Should material get marked as AI-created, set automatic notifications to inform key parties.
- Include a 'Filter by Zapier' phase to divide the sequence: advance solely if the review level surpasses a limit (e.g., 70% AI probability).
- For notifications, connect Slack, messaging, or Microsoft Teams. Select 'Send Channel Message' in Slack, say, including elements like the file reference, review level, and highlighted areas.
For manual confirmation of non-flagged material, direct it to a collective Google Docs area or initiate a Microsoft Word assessment duty through messaging. This secures human evaluation of borderline instances, preserving standards. You might also insert a pause step to group notifications, avoiding excessive alerts.
Troubleshooting Common Issues
Assembling a Zapier sequence may encounter snags-here are solutions for typical problems:
- Trigger Failures: Should Google Docs miss new files, check directory access and trial with a basic file. Confirm the starter checks often (every 1-15 minutes, based on your subscription).
- Integration Glitches: For Microsoft Word steps, validate API permissions in your Microsoft profile. If a web reviser step delays, trim the text entry or employ Zapier's scripting phase for tailored extraction.
- False Positives: Adjust review limits in your automated step. Experiment with varied examples-AI versus human-composed-to polish conditions.
